STM32技术项目资源合集:C语言实践百例精解

版权申诉
0 下载量 104 浏览量 更新于2024-10-05 收藏 4.59MB RAR 举报
资源摘要信息:"基于stm32实现C语言趣味程序百例精解(含项目资料+原理图+ppt).rar" 1. STM32单片机与C语言结合应用 STM32是一种广泛使用的ARM Cortex-M微控制器,其强大的处理能力和丰富的外设支持使其在嵌入式系统开发领域受到青睐。C语言作为一种高效、灵活的编程语言,在嵌入式开发中占有重要地位。该资源以STM32单片机为平台,提供了100个C语言编写的趣味程序案例,帮助开发者通过实例学习并掌握如何利用STM32进行硬件操作和功能实现。 2. 多技术领域的项目源码 资源集成了多个技术领域的源码,包括但不限于前端、后端、移动开发、操作系统、人工智能、物联网、信息化管理、数据库、硬件开发、大数据和网站开发等。这些源码可以作为学习和项目实践的宝贵资料,让学习者能够跨学科学习,并了解不同技术领域的实际应用场景。 3. 项目资源的实用性与质量 所有提供的项目源码都经过了严格的测试,保证了功能的正常运作,且在上传之前确保了稳定性和可靠性。这意味着学习者可以直接使用这些代码,无需担心基础问题,从而更快地投入到学习和项目开发中。 4. 适用人群与学习进阶 本资源非常适合于希望深入学习各个技术领域的新手和有一定基础的进阶学习者。无论是作为毕业设计、课程设计、大作业、工程实训还是初期项目立项,资源都提供了足够的支持。同时,资源中的项目案例具有较高的学习和借鉴价值,可以作为学习者模仿和扩展的起点。 5. 自主学习与交流互动 除了提供大量的项目资源,资源还鼓励学习者在使用过程中遇到问题时与博主沟通,以获得及时的解答。这种方式能够促进学习者之间的交流和学习,共同进步。 6. 项目资源的可修改性和扩展性 对于有一定基础或者热衷于研究的学习者来说,资源中的基础代码可以成为创新的起点。他们可以在现有项目的基础上进行修改和扩展,以实现更加复杂和个性化的功能。 7. 标签解读 "源代码"表明资源包含了实用的程序代码;"毕业设计"强调资源对学术研究和项目设计的适用性;"心梓知识"可能指资源中包含的核心知识和技术要点;"计算机资料"和"数据集"则涉及了与计算机科学相关的广泛信息,包括项目资料和原理图等。 8. 文件名称解析 "资料来源.txt"可能提供了关于资源来源和使用的说明,有助于学习者了解如何获取和使用这些资料;"0428"可能是一个项目文件夹或者某个特定项目的代号;"C语言趣味程序百例精解"则直接对应资源的标题,说明了资源的核心内容。 总结来说,该资源为想要学习和实践STM32与C语言结合应用的开发者提供了一个宝贵的资料库,覆盖了多个技术领域,并且注重实用性和学习者的实际操作能力。通过这些高质量的项目案例,学习者能够更加深入地理解和掌握各种技术的应用,并且能够鼓励自主学习与创新思维的培养。